错误对象不包含带有1个参数的构造函数

我有一个要运行的核心项目,但出现错误。

这是我的代码:

 public class OrderDetailsContext
    {
        public OrderDetailsContext(DbContextOptions<OrderDetailsContext> options) : base(options)
        { }

        //defining table
        public DbSet<OrderDetails> OrderDetails { get; set; }
    }

但是我有我提到的这个错误 我该怎么办?

bbqweerewr 回答:错误对象不包含带有1个参数的构造函数

您没有从DbContext继承。

 public class OrderDetailsContext : DbContext
    {
        public OrderDetailsContext(DbContextOptions<OrderDetailsContext> options) : base(options)
        { }

        //defining table
        public DbSet<OrderDetails> OrderDetails { get; set; }
    }
,

您的课程应该继承来自 DbContext 课程:

public class OrderDetailsContext: DbContext
        {
            public OrderDetailsContext(DbContextOptions<OrderDetailsContext> options) : base(options)
            { 
            }

            //defining table
            public DbSet<OrderDetails> OrderDetails { get; set; }
        }

Help Link 1

help link 2

本文链接:https://www.f2er.com/2863120.html

大家都在问